Lake Mackenzie Campsite
This is a walk-in, Great Walk campsite on the Routeburn Track, Fiordland National Park. Bookings required in the Great Walks season. (via site)

Do I need to book ahead for Lake Mackenzie Campsite?
Yes, a reservation is required. You can check availability on the official website.
Is there drinking water at Lake Mackenzie Campsite?
Yes, drinking water is available.
Are there toilets at Lake Mackenzie Campsite?
Yes, toilets are available on site.
Are dogs allowed at Lake Mackenzie Campsite?
No, dogs are not allowed.
When is Lake Mackenzie Campsite open?
Listed opening times: 24/7.
Who runs Lake Mackenzie Campsite?
Lake Mackenzie Campsite is operated by Department of Conservation.
